26Alyeska's Story

Meet Alyeska<br/><br/>Spayed female<br/><br/>50ish lbs<br/><br/>Around 1 year old<br/><br/>Dogs: Yes<br/><br/>Cats: Indoor, yes<br/><br/>House trained: Yes<br/><br/>Crate trained: Yes<br/><br/>Hey hey hey everyone. It's Alyeska or as my mom calls me Aly here! Wanted to let everyone know how I'm doing and give you the most recent update on my life with my foster peeps!<br/><br/>Well, I'm happy to report that life is good. I am a 50ish pound Malinois mix and a youngster, maybe a year. I'm am completely house broken and haven't had a single accident in the house. And although it's not my favorite place, I much prefer the sofa, I will hang out in my crate at night and for all my meals! I love, and I mean love tennis balls and playing fetch. Chewing on pine cones, and really love to play in water; the pond, puddles, the hose, if it's water then I'm in! I also love every other dog I meet and just love to run and play with everyone, even the cats... which they don't seem to enjoy as much as me. But mom & dad have told me that I need to be nice and we've worked it out in the house and mostly outside, but sometimes I just want to give them a hug so bad that I might chase them a bit. But I have never tried to bite or eat them!!!<br/><br/>Some of the things that seems to really get mom a little exasperated is when I pull on my leash, but we've gotten so much better with that and I really just like to run along side her when we're on our walks! I'm learning that she's supposed to go through the door first, but I'm just so excited to go out and play that I forget sometimes. She calls me her triple expresso girl, i think because i have so much energy. I really need to get my burn on in the morning and luckily mom and me go on a 4.5 miles walk. After which I am much better behaved and open to learning some new stuff. Y'all will think this is funny, but mom is trying to teach me "The Art of Doing Nothing!" Yup, it's a thing. I'm learning to rewire and repurpose my energy and just relax, which is hard, cuz I like to go go go! Although my sisters and bro are really good at it.<br/><br/>Mom says that she thinks that if someone is willing to be as dedicated to training as I am, it will be a good fit. But until I met Mom and Dad, no-one really had any good expectations of me, so I didn't really know how I was supposed to behave. I heard her say that i've come a really long way and she and Dad see the improvements everyday.<br/><br/>Okay, i'm gonna let Mom say a couple things. Paws out peeps!<br/><br/>Mom here! Aly is a really sweet and amazing girl and has come a very long way in the 3 weeks that she's been with us. There is still room for improvement and we're confident that if you are willing to put some time regarding training and setting boundaries, Aly will blossom in your home. She is ALOT of dog! She's smart, strong, and very energetic. She's not the dog for you if you'll need to leave her alone while everyone is at work or school. She wants her people. She likes to help with every chore inside and out. She has never gone anywhere without us, so she's earned the freedom of being off leash on our property. And has a pretty good recall. So... if you are a busy body and like to walk, hike, work around your yard and have time for this girl, you'll love her. Please give her a chance, she's amazing and we are certainly going to miss her.
